  4. Here is my take on the Chevy II Gasser....build was fairly straightforward....door handles bust way too easily, hope you have spares. Suspension setups are fairly fiddly, take your time and it will be fine. Blower is too big, or engine is too small. Taillight and reverse light assemblies are not easy to install...but I am half blind so that is no surprise. Not a period correct gasser but should pass as a replica or show 'n go weekend racer. All in all, great kit.
